Azure Virtual Machines(Azure VM)
Microsoft Azureが提供するIaaS型の仮想マシンサービス。Windows・Linuxに対応し、数分でサーバーを起動できる。オンプレミスサーバーのクラウド移行にも広く利用される。
Azure Virtual Machines とは?
**Azure Virtual Machines(Azure VM)**は、Microsoft Azureが提供する仮想マシン(VM)サービスです。AWSのEC2、GCPのCompute Engineに相当するIaaSサービスで、Windows ServerからLinux各種まで幅広いOSに対応しています。
主な特徴
- 豊富なサイズ: 汎用・コンピューティング最適化・メモリ最適化・GPU搭載など数百種類
- スポットVM: 余剰リソースを低価格で利用(最大90%割引、中断あり)
- 予約インスタンス: 1〜3年の事前予約で最大72%割引
- Azure Hybrid Benefit: オンプレのWindowsライセンスを流用してコスト削減
VMのサイズ命名規則
Standard_D4s_v5 の例:
- D: 汎用(メモリ集約はE、コンピューティング集約はF)
- 4: vCPU数
- s: Premium SSD対応
- v5: 第5世代
可用性オプション
| オプション | SLA | 用途 |
|---|---|---|
| 可用性セット | 99.95% | 同一DC内の冗長化 |
| 可用性ゾーン | 99.99% | 異なるDC間の冗長化 |
| VM スケールセット | 99.99% | 自動スケーリング |
まとめ
Azure VMはリフト&シフト(既存サーバーをそのまま移行)に最適です。ただしPaaSやコンテナへの移行も検討し、長期的な運用コストを最小化することを推奨します。
関連する用語 (クラウド)
全40件を見るIT用語: Amazon SQS(Simple Queue Service)とは|疎結合を実現するメッセージキュー
マイクロサービス間の非同期通信・バッファリングを実現するAWSのフルマネージドメッセージキューSQSを解説。
Cloud Storage(GCS)
GCPのオブジェクトストレージサービス。イレブンナイン(99.999999999%)の耐久性を持ち、画像・動画・バックアップ・静的サイトホスティングに広く使われる。AWSのS3に相当。
BigQuery(ビッグクエリ)
Googleのサーバーレスなデータウェアハウスサービス。ペタバイト規模のデータにSQLで高速クエリを実行でき、分析基盤として世界中の企業に採用されている。
サーバーレス (Serverless)
開発者がサーバーの構築や保守を意識することなく、プログラムの実行環境だけを利用できる仕組み。
Cloud Functions(GCP)
GCPのFaaS(Function as a Service)型サーバーレスサービス。単一の関数をHTTPトリガー・Pub/Sub・Cloud Storageイベント等で実行でき、完全従量課金で運用できる。
IT用語: GKE(Google Kubernetes Engine)とは|Kubernetes発祥のGCPマネージドK8s
Kubernetesを生んだGoogleが提供するマネージドKubernetesサービスGKEの特徴とAutopilotモードを解説。